School Development Plan (Campus Master Plan)

Guide Project Academy is committed to long-term growth. The Campus Master Plan includes:

  • Modern classrooms and lecture halls
  • Library with digital learning resources
  • Computer and science laboratories
  • Dormitories for students from distant areas
  • Dining hall and kitchen facilities
  • Sports grounds and playgrounds
  • Community center for workshops and events

This plan shows donors how their support contributes to a sustainable, world-class learning environment, ensuring the school can serve generations of students.
